Table of Contents
Implementing the hreflang tag correctly is essential for websites that target multiple dialects or regional variants of the same language. This ensures that search engines understand the relationship between different versions of your content, improving SEO and user experience.
What is the hreflang Tag?
The hreflang tag is an HTML attribute used to specify the language and regional targeting of a webpage. It helps search engines serve the most appropriate version of a page based on the user’s language preferences or location.
Why Use hreflang for Multiple Dialects and Variants?
When your website offers content in different dialects or regional variants, using hreflang tags prevents duplicate content issues and ensures users see the most relevant version. For example, a site with American English and British English versions benefits from proper hreflang implementation.
Common Scenarios
- Different dialects of the same language (e.g., en-US vs. en-GB)
- Regional variants (e.g., fr-FR vs. fr-CA)
- Language and region combinations (e.g., es-MX vs. es-ES)
Implementing hreflang Tags Correctly
To implement hreflang tags effectively, include them in the <head> section of each page. Use link tags to reference all language versions of a page, including itself, to establish mutual relationships.
Example Code
Suppose you have three versions of a page: English (US), English (UK), and French (France). The hreflang tags would look like this:
<link rel="alternate" hreflang="en-US" href="https://example.com/en-us/" />
<link rel="alternate" hreflang="en-GB" href="https://example.com/en-gb/" />
<link rel="alternate" hreflang="fr-FR" href="https://example.com/fr-fr/" />
Additionally, include a x-default link for users with unspecified language preferences:
<link rel="alternate" hreflang="x-default" href="https://example.com/" />
Best Practices
- Ensure all versions of a page are correctly linked with hreflang tags.
- Keep hreflang tags consistent across all pages.
- Use valid language and region codes as per ISO standards.
- Test your implementation with tools like Google Search Console.
Conclusion
Properly implementing hreflang tags is vital for sites with multiple dialects and regional variants. It improves search engine understanding, reduces duplicate content issues, and provides a better experience for users worldwide. Regularly review and test your hreflang setup to ensure optimal performance.